In that sense, the person in charge of taking action was Darko Rajakovic, coach of the Toronto Raptors, who exploded against the referees of the game that his team lost on the Los Angeles Lakers court by 132-131.

In LA they are clear that as long as their stellar connection is healthy, there are plenty of reasons to dream big. It – logically – is made up of LeBron James and Anthony Davis, who, aware of the situation in Los Angeles, continue to join forces.

They recently defeated the Toronto Raptors (132-131) in a very tight clash in which the strength of the “King” and his clairvoyance in passing (22 points, but 12 assists), and an unruly Davis (41 points and 11 rebounds) showed that the gold and purple fans can trust.

But the euphoria of that team contrasts with that of the last opponent, who missed a practically unforgivable game. However, in addition to the traditional actions that a match can offer, they consider that different controversial situations occurred in the outcome and that the person in charge of dispensing justice tilted the court to the other side (especially in free throws).

Hard release from the coach

Although the anger is widespread, the person in charge of making it public was the coach, who was not afraid of retaliation and fired with thick ammunition. “It’s outrageous. What happened tonight is completely shit, it’s a shame for the referees and the league for allowing this,” said the Serbian coach, tremendously angry, in a press conference that did not go unnoticed.

Far from settling for that initial story, he continued with the harsh defense. “Twenty-three free throws for them in the fourth quarter and us, two. How are we going to play like that? I understand the respect for All-Stars and all that, but we also have All-Stars.

How is it possible that Scottie Barnes, who is an All-Star class player, always goes to the hoop with force, without flopping and without trying to get fouls called, and he only gets two free throws in the entire game?” he reflected.

The suspicions against arbitration did not stop there and he continued with the analysis, making a clear hint at the disparity of criteria when making decisions. “How is it possible? How are you going to explain that to me? Did they have to win? If that’s the case, let them tell us so we don’t show up to the game.

Let them give them the victory. But what happened tonight is not It was fair and it is not the first time for us (…). What is happening throughout the season is complete shit,” he said.

Rajakovic continued to be furious with his gaze and assured that the referees “see what they want to see” and that they do not listen to the players. “Throughout the game (the Lakers) had 36 free throws and 23 in the fourth quarter alone.

What are we talking about? How are we supposed to play? (…). I tell our players to be professionals, let them continue fighting, let them go for the next one. But, until when?”, he closed.
